Content Briefing 101: For Writers & Strategists
A content briefing represents the vital roadmap for ensuring effective content creation. The outline clearly communicates the project’s objectives, target audience, and desired outcomes to writers and content strategists. Consider this as a mutual understanding which everyone is on the same page.
A well-crafted content briefing typically includes:
- Topic & Keyword Focus: Identifying the specific subject matter and relevant keywords.
- Target Audience: Identifying who you’re writing with.
- Content Goals: What results we intend to achieve .
- Style & Tone: Maintaining the appropriate voice and manner .
- Format & Length: Defining the type of content (e.g., blog post ) and its estimated word count.
- Call to Action: What clear action you want the reader to perform.
With providing the comprehensive information, we empower writers to produce high-quality, aligned content designed to fulfills overall content goals.
